Italian Crescent Roll Sandwich Bake – Easy Party Favorite Ingredients
For the Base
- 2 cans crescent roll dough (refrigerated) – This flaky dough serves as the perfect vessel for all the delicious fillings.
For the Filling
- 6 slices ham (thinly sliced) – Adds a savory richness that complements the other meats beautifully.
- 6 slices salami (thinly sliced) – Brings a bold flavor that enhances the Italian vibe of this dish.
- 6 slices pepperoni (thinly sliced) – A classic favorite that adds a spicy kick to every bite.
- 8 ounces mozzarella cheese (shredded) – Melts beautifully to create a gooey, cheesy texture you’ll love.
- 1 cup marinara sauce (for dipping) – Perfect for dunking and adds an extra layer of flavor to your sandwiches.
For the Seasoning
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ning – A blend that infuses the bake with authentic Italian aromas and tastes.
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der – Elevates the flavor profile with its aromatic and savory notes.
- 1 teaspoon onion powder – Adds depth and sweetness, enhancing the overall taste of this easy party favorite.

How to Make Italian Crescent Roll Sandwich Bake – Easy Party Favorite
Step 1:
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) to ensure it’s hot enough for a perfect bake. This temperature will help achieve that delicious golden-brown crust we all love.
Step 2:
While the oven is heating, grab a baking dish and generously grease it with non-stick spray. This will make it easier to slice and serve the sandwich bake once it’s done cooking.
Step 3:
Unroll one can of crescent roll dough and carefully lay it in the bottom of your greased baking dish. Make sure to press the seams together well so that you have a solid base for your filling.
Step 4:
Now it’s time to layer in the goodness! Place the thinly sliced ham, salami, and pepperoni evenly over the dough. Top this off with the shredded mozzarella cheese, making sure every bite will be cheesy and flavorful.
Step 5:
Sprinkle the Italian seasoning, garlic powder, and onion powder over the cheese. This step adds an aromatic touch that elevates the overall flavor profile of your sandwich bake.
Step 6:
Unroll the second can of crescent roll dough and gently place it over the top of your layered ingredients. Be sure to seal the edges well to keep all those delicious fillings inside as it bakes.
Step 7:
Slide your baking dish into the preheated oven and bake for about 25 minutes. Keep an eye on it until it’s golden brown and bubbly—this is when you know it’s ready to come out!
Step 8:
Once baked, remove your sandwich bake from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es. This will make slicing easier and keep you from burning your fingers on that gooey cheese.
Step 9:
Serve your warm sandwich bake with marinara sauce on the side for dipping. Enjoy this delightful treat with friends or family at your next gathering!

To store your Italian Crescent Roll Sandwich Bake in the refrigerator, allow it to cool to room temperature, then transfer it to an airtight container. It will keep well in the fridge for up to 3 days.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, simply reheat individual portions in the microwave or place the whole b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es until heated through; this helps restore its flaky texture.
This dish also freezes well, though the crescent roll dough may lose some of its flakiness upon thawing. To freeze, cut the sandwich bake into portions and wrap each piece tightly in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e container or bag. It can be stored in the freezer for up to 2 months. To reheat, thaw overnight in the fridge and warm it up in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 15-20 minutes; this will help maintain its taste and texture.

Italian Crescent Roll Sandwich Bake - Easy Party Favorite
Ingredients
Method
-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
- Grease a baking dish with non-stick spray.
- Unroll one can of crescent roll dough and lay it in the bottom of the baking dish, pressing the seams together to form a solid base.
- Layer the ham, salami, pepperoni, and mozzarella cheese evenly over the dough.
- Sprinkle Italian seasoning, garlic powder, and onion powder over the cheese.
- Unroll the second can of crescent roll dough and place it over the top, sealing the edges.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 25 minutes or until golden brown.
- Remove from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es before slicing.
- Serve warm with marinara sauce for dipping.
